Sale!
4.5/5
262 reviews
Sale!
4.5/5
283 reviews
Sale!
4.5/5
289 reviews
Sale!
4.5/5
76 reviews
Sale!
4.5/5
193 reviews
Sale!
4.5/5
204 reviews
Sale!
4.5/5
240 reviews
Sale!
4.5/5
171 reviews
Sale!
4.5/5
200 reviews
Sale!
4.5/5
264 reviews
Sale!
4.5/5
271 reviews
Sale!
4.5/5
86 reviews
Sale!
4.5/5
281 reviews
Sale!
4.5/5
74 reviews
Sale!
4.5/5
85 reviews
Sale!
4.5/5
107 reviews
Sale!
4.5/5
183 reviews
Sale!
4.5/5
168 reviews
Sale!
4.5/5
120 reviews
Sale!
4.5/5
193 reviews
Sale!
4.5/5
111 reviews
